AWS Adds Domain and Date Filters to Bedrock AgentCore Web Search Tool
AWS has introduced domain allow-listing and publish-date filtering for the Web Search tool within Amazon Bedrock AgentCore, its managed runtime for building AI agents. The new controls let developers restrict an agent's web searches to approved domains and exclude results older than a specified date, before those results reach the agent's reasoning process. This addresses a longstanding challenge in deploying AI agents, where models cannot independently assess source quality or freshness. Practical use cases include customer support agents limited to official documentation, research agents requiring up-to-date information, and compliance workflows that must audit which sources an AI was permitted to use. The filters also reduce exposure to prompt injection attacks by limiting reachable web content to a smaller set of known domains; pricing implications of the update have not been confirmed by AWS.
